prevnext   » Startseite » Haupt-Referenz » Funktions-Referenz » selectTime()

selectTime()

Eine einzelne Komponenten (von Sekundenbruchteil bis Jahr) einer Zeitangabe errechnen.

Syntax:

int32 selectTime ( time, selector )

Parameter:

time Bei diesem Parameter handelt es sich um eine Datums- und/oder Zeitangabe. Der Parameter muss vom Typ NONE, INT32, INT64, FLOAT oder STRING sein. Weitere Details zu Zeitangaben sind unter »Zeitangaben« beschrieben.
selector Ein Index, wie er unter splitTime() beschrieben ist.

Beschreibung:

Die Funktion selectTime() arbeitet ähnlich wie splitTime(), jedoch wird nur eine einzige Komponente errechnet.

Der Parameter selector indiziert dabei die Komponente. Unter splitTime() sind alle einzelnen Inidizes aufgeführt.

Funktionsergebnis:   INT32/NONE

Bei einem fhelerhaften Index wird NONE als FUnktionsergebnis geliefert.

Anderenfalls wird eine 32-Bit Ganzzahl mit dem gewünschten Wert geliefert.

Siehe auch:
 Zeitangaben   splitTime() 

Weitere ähnliche Funktionen:

Datum & Zeit
Funktion Kurzinfo
date() Zeitangabe in das Datumsformat (INT32) wandeln.
dayName()
easterDate() Berechne den Ostersonntag einen gegebenen Jahres.
easterDayOfMarch() Berechne den Ostersonntag einen gegebenen Jahres und liefere den März-Tag.
monthName()
mSec() Relative Zeit in Millisekunden zu einem nicht weiter definiertem Startpunkt.
nSec() Relative Zeit in Nanosekunden zu einem nicht weiter definiertem Startpunkt.
printInterval() textausgabe eines Zeitintervalles
printTime() Formatierte Ausgabe einer Datums- und Zeitangabe.
scanInterval()
scanTime()
sec() Relative Zeit in Sekunden zu einem nicht weiter definiertem Startpunkt.
selectTime() Eine einzelne Komponenten (von Sekundenbruchteil bis Jahr) einer Zeitangabe errechnen.
splitTime() Die einzelnen Komponenten (von Sekundenbruchteile bis Jahr) einer Zeitangabe errechnen.
time() Zeitangabe in das Zeitformat (INT64) wandeln.
unix2date() Eine Zeitangabe im Unix-Format in eine Zeitangabe im Datumsformat wandeln.
unix2time() Eine Zeitangabe im Unix-Format in eine 64-Bit-Zeitangabe wandeln.
unixTime() Zeitangabe in das Unix-Zeitformat (INT32) wandeln.
uSec() Relative Zeit in Mikrosekunden zu einem nicht weiter definiertem Startpunkt.
 
Auswahl eines Parameters
Funktion Kurzinfo
first()
firstDef()
last()
lastDef()
parm()
select()
selectTime() Eine einzelne Komponenten (von Sekundenbruchteil bis Jahr) einer Zeitangabe errechnen.